The classic album of SBS drama "Penthouse," which has recorded high ratings and has driven countless drama fans into a frenzy, will be released. The drama is about the distorted desires and revenge of the top-class people living in a fictional space called Hera Palace, but the plot unfolds in the background of Cheongah Art High School, and many songs and classical masterpieces actually appear because the main female characters are sopranos.

Penthouse Classical Album is released as a CD package and a USB package. The CD package consists of two regular CDs (3-stage digital pack format), and CD1 contains vocal songs, and CD2 contains instrumental songs. All of the songs featured in Penthouse are the songs that appeared in Season 1, but the 'Una Voce Foco Fa' of the Rossini Opera [Sevilia's Barber] which Seo-jin Cheon sang at her concert, was specially added as the last track of CD1. 

The USB package contains 25 MP3 files (320kbps, 44.100kHz) on an external USB (USB 2.0, 4GB memory). If you don't have a player and can't listen to the CD, you can easily enjoy music by inserting it into the USB port of your car or laptop.
